Cohort
A group of individuals sharing a common factor (e.g., age, experience) within a specified period, often studied to identify patterns over time.
Longitudinal
A research design that involves repeated observations of the same variables over short or long periods of time.
Cross-sectional
An observational study type that examines data collected from a population or a representative sample at one particular point in time.
